Seafood Bisque - A Creamy Ocean Dream

1. Sauté the Aromatics:

Melt the butter in a large, heavy-bottomed pot over medium heat.

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, sautéing for 3-4 minutes until softened and fragrant.

2. Create the Roux:

Stir in the flour, cooking and stirring continuously for 1-2 minutes. This forms a roux that will thicken the bisque.

3. Add the Liquids:

Gradually whisk in the seafood or chicken broth, ensuring no lumps form.

Add the white grape juice (or water) and continue whisking until the mixture is smooth and begins to thicken.

Stir in the heavy cream, Old Bay seasoning, paprika, salt, and black pepper.

Bring the mixture to a gentle simmer.

4. Add the Seafood:

Gently fold in the shrimp, crab meat, and chopped lobster meat.

Simmer for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the shrimp turn pink and the bisque reaches a luscious, creamy consistency.
